Private Percy Arthur John White (5951, 19th Battalion) was a labourer from Paddington, NSW. He enlisted in June 1916. Percy was accidentally killed on 28 June 1917 when a grenade exploded in his hand. He was buried nearby in the Martinpuich British Cemetery, France. His mother wrote that he was 17 years 10 months. Percy’s uncle, Private John Allan White, died of wounds received in action near Armentieres in December 1917.
